Transaction 77aaef799c95fc12f5eda1ea6a73a8e89c4a80b1b2cf913c2aef9fb3688ab59d

100 Input
1 Outputs
  • 77aaef799c95fc12f5eda1ea6a73a8e89c4a80b1b2cf913c2aef9fb3688ab59d:0
  • value  417197531
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h